On Wed, 1 Jul 2009 11:56:47 -0300 Ufa <[email protected]> wrote: > After that I rebooted in the 2.6.29 and removed the madwifi > So I "modprobe ath5k" and it worked good, NetworkManager found the > networks, and all good, but... :( > > In WPA connectins I get disconnect when the wifi traffic gets medium to > heavy, i.e. almost all programs make it disconnect. > > Is it normal, or Did I make something wrong? :(
Maybe one of: ath5k cannot connect to WPA networks with a AR242x (or AR5007) chipset http://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=13218 or: ath5k modul disconnect with Access-Point http://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=12702 I don't use WPA/WPA2, but I have had disconnects using ath5k that I never had with madwifi resembling the second bug (i.e. 'No ProbeResp ... assume out of range' errors). I simply toggle FnF2 and then I'm back in business again. It doesn't happen frequently enough on open networks to be much of a bother.
